(1) Any employer declaring or causing a lockout contrary to the provisions of this article 1 commits a class 2 misdemeanor. Each day or part of a day that such lockout exists shall constitute a separate offense under this section. (2) Any employee who goes on strike contrary to the provisions of this article 1 commits a class 2 misdemeanor. Each day or part of a day that the employee is on strike shall constitute a separate offense under this section. (3) Any person who incites, encourages, or aids in any manner any employer to declare or continue a lockout, or any employee to go or continue on strike contrary to the provisions of this article 1, commits a petty offense.
C.R.S. § 8-1-129
Strikes and lockouts
